make test fails for URI and HTML::Parser unless defined $Config{useperlio}

Hi,

testing URI and HTML::Parser fails if perl is compiled w/o perlio (not much of 
a deal nowadays).

Please consider the following patches.

1. URI

--- t/iri.t~    2010-01-16 08:08:39.000000000 +0100          
+++ t/iri.t     2010-04-07 16:18:37.502602019 +0200          
@@ -2,7 +2,14 @@                                             
                                                             
 use utf8;                                                   
 use strict;                                                 
-use Test::More tests => 26;                                 
+use Test::More;                                             
+use Config;                                                 
+                                                            
+if (defined $Config{useperlio}) {                           
+    plan tests=>26;                                         
+} else {                                                    
+    plan skip_all=>'this perl doesn\'t support PerlIO layers';
+}                                                             
                                                               
 use URI;                                                      
 use URI::IRI;                                                 


2. HTML::Parser

--- t/unicode.t~        2008-11-17 11:34:35.000000000 +0100              
+++ t/unicode.t 2010-04-07 16:38:04.213354373 +0200                      
@@ -139,32 +139,38 @@                                                    
 is(@warn, 1);                                                           
 like($warn[0], qr/^Parsing of undecoded UTF-8 will give garbage when decoding 
entities/);
                                                                                          
-@warn = ();                                                                              
-@parsed = ();                                                                            
-open($fh, "<:raw:utf8", $file) || die;                                                   
-$p->parse_file($fh);                                                                     
-is(@parsed, "11");                                                                       
-is($parsed[6][0], "start");                                                              
-is($parsed[6][8]{id}, "\x{2665}\x{2665}");                                               
-is($parsed[7][0], "text");                                                               
-is($parsed[7][1], "&hearts; Love \x{2665}");                                             
-is($parsed[7][2], "\x{2665} Love \x{2665}");                                             
-is($parsed[10][3], (-s $file) - 2 * 4);                                                  
-is(@warn, 0);                                                                            
+SKIP: {                                                                                  
+    use Config;                                                                          
+    skip 'this perl doesn\'t support PerlIO layers', 16                                  
+        unless defined $Config{useperlio};                                               
                                                                                          
-@warn = ();                                                                              
-@parsed = ();                                                                            
-open($fh, "<:raw", $file) || die;                                                        
-$p->utf8_mode(1);                                                                        
-$p->parse_file($fh);                                                                     
-is(@parsed, "11");
-is($parsed[6][0], "start");
-is($parsed[6][8]{id}, "\xE2\x99\xA5\xE2\x99\xA5");
-is($parsed[7][0], "text");
-is($parsed[7][1], "&hearts; Love \xE2\x99\xA5");
-is($parsed[7][2], "\xE2\x99\xA5 Love \xE2\x99\xA5");
-is($parsed[10][3], -s $file);
-is(@warn, 0);
+    @warn = ();
+    @parsed = ();
+    open($fh, "<:raw:utf8", $file) || die;
+    $p->parse_file($fh);
+    is(@parsed, "11");
+    is($parsed[6][0], "start");
+    is($parsed[6][8]{id}, "\x{2665}\x{2665}");
+    is($parsed[7][0], "text");
+    is($parsed[7][1], "&hearts; Love \x{2665}");
+    is($parsed[7][2], "\x{2665} Love \x{2665}");
+    is($parsed[10][3], (-s $file) - 2 * 4);
+    is(@warn, 0);
+
+    @warn = ();
+    @parsed = ();
+    open($fh, "<:raw", $file) || die;
+    $p->utf8_mode(1);
+    $p->parse_file($fh);
+    is(@parsed, "11");
+    is($parsed[6][0], "start");
+    is($parsed[6][8]{id}, "\xE2\x99\xA5\xE2\x99\xA5");
+    is($parsed[7][0], "text");
+    is($parsed[7][1], "&hearts; Love \xE2\x99\xA5");
+    is($parsed[7][2], "\xE2\x99\xA5 Love \xE2\x99\xA5");
+    is($parsed[10][3], -s $file);
+    is(@warn, 0);
+}

 unlink($file);
